    You do get skill exp from it --- I even got a skill up once during a buff refresh.

    Also, buff casting design is flawed --- you can't recast a buff until it actually flashes. This is the most trivial way to prevent skill levelling with buffs, since you need forever to be able to cast a buff again (along the same ways, that's why you can't cast Heal if you are at full health).

    It is bugged design because it's annoying for players; they can't just do a full refresh of all buffs in one go, but have to refresh each buff individually when it starts flashing.

    The anti-skilling effect could also be achieved by giving skill exp based on how much time you still had left: if you cast a buff without it being active you'd get 100% skill exp; if you recast the buff while you still have 90% time left you would only get 10% of the normal skill exp.
